I was only about 5 months along when I started waking up with a soaked t-shirt. My mom and grandma freaked out, saying it was really weird. Most women I have talked to say they didnt get their milk in until after birth. Did I get mine early because my husband and I were sexually active during my pregnancy and my nipples were stimulated, or is it something that just happens?

I am not certain of the cause, but I produced colostrum very early in pregnancy also, and have produced it every month since having babies! I am in my 40's now and still produce colostrum with every menstrual cycle. One doctor told me it is just the difference in hormone levels from woman to woman. Hope this helps.
